The rapid development of modern industries, such as aerospace and automotive manufacturing and biomedical engineering, has led to higher performance requirements for materials. Alloy development through conventional design strategies based on one or two principal elements may have reached a bottleneck. Recently, the discovery of multi-principal element alloys and high-entropy alloys (HEAs) has opened up new possibilities, and they are considered to represent a flexible paradigm in developing novel alloys with desirable properties. Their design requires a deep understanding of complex alloying principles, thermodynamics, and kinetics. Besides the properties of bulk materials, surface modification technologies are also essential in tailoring the surface properties of materials, such as corrosion resistance, wear resistance, and biocompatibility, without sacrificing the bulk properties. Thus, a combination of multi-principal element design strategies and surface modification technologies can represent an effective way to enhance the overall mechanical properties, durability, and functionality of materials, which is of great significance in the development of modern industries.
